Crispy Fish Fry Recipe
Ingredients
1) 1 kg Katla fish (washed and drained)
2) 5-6 green chilies
3) 2-inch piece of ginger
4) 20-25 garlic cloves (use more if you like garlic)
5) 1 tsp roasted cumin powder
6) ½ tsp turmeric powder
7) 1 tsp red chili powder
8) 1 tsp garam masala
9) 1 tbsp chili flakes (or red chili powder)
10) 1 tsp carom seeds (ajwain)
11) ¾ tsp salt (adjust to taste)
12) 2 tsp crushed whole coriander
13) 2-3 tbsp lemon juice
14) 1 tsp roasted kasoori methi (dried fenugreek leaves)
15) A pinch of orange-red food color (optional)
16) 2 tbsp gram flour
17) 2 tbsp rice flour (or cornflour)
18) Oil for frying

Step 1: Marinating the Fish
After washing 1 kg of Katla fish thoroughly, place it in a strainer to drain any excess water. Once the fish is dry, it’s time to marinate.
In a mixer, blend 5-6 green chilies, 2-inch ginger piece, and 20-25 garlic cloves with 1-2 tbsp water to make a smooth paste.
Add the paste to the fish and mix it well.
Add the following spices:
1) 1 tsp roasted cumin powder
2) ½ tsp turmeric powder
3) 1 tsp red chili powder
4) 1 tsp garam masala
5) 1 tbsp chili flakes
6) 1 tsp carom seeds
7) ¾ tsp salt
8) 2 tsp crushed whole coriander
9) 2-3 tbsp lemon juice
10) 1 tsp kasoori methi
11) A pinch of orange-red food color (optional)
Mix all the ingredients thoroughly and rub the spices into the fish. Let it marinate for at least 2-3 hours. The longer the fish marinates, the tastier it will be. You can also marinate it overnight in the fridge.
Step 2: Preparing the Coating
In a separate bowl, mix the following ingredients:
1) 2 tbsp gram flour
2) 2 tbsp rice flour (or cornflour)
Mix the flours thoroughly to remove any lumps. Gradually add a little water to form a thick paste. The batter should be thick enough to coat the fish properly. Once the paste is ready, we will apply it to the marinated fish just before frying.
Step 3: Frying the Fish
Heat oil in a pan on medium to high flame.
Coat the marinated fish pieces with the prepared paste of gram flour and rice flour.
Carefully place the fish pieces in the hot oil. Fry them on medium flame for 2-3 minutes without touching them to allow them to firm up and become crispy.
After 2-3 minutes, flip the fish to the other side and fry it until it becomes golden brown and crispy. Fry each piece for about 6-7 minutes until it is cooked through.
* Avoid frying on high flame to prevent burning the outside while keeping the inside raw. Similarly, don’t fry on low flame, as this will make the fish absorb excess oil.

Step 4: Draining the Oil
Once the fish is crispy and golden, remove it from the oil and place it on absorbent paper or a tissue to drain any excess oil. Repeat the process for the remaining fish pieces.
Step 5: Serving the Fish Fry
Serve the crispy, flavorful fish fry hot with green coriander mint chutney, onion lachhu, or even with dal and rice.
